When formulating with Sodium Ascorbyl Phosphate, it's crucial to understand the recommended concentrations. Industry standards suggest that optimal concentration ranges from 1% to 5% in skincare products. Lower concentrations may yield minimal effects. Conversely, higher concentrations can lead to skin sensitivity. It’s essential to strike the right balance.
Mixing Sodium Ascorbyl Phosphate with other ingredients can enhance efficacy. For example, combining it with Hyaluronic Acid can boost hydration. However, be cautious with pH levels; Sodium Ascorbyl Phosphate works best in a pH range of 6 to 7. Formulations outside this range may not show the desired benefits.
Tips for effective use include starting with a lower concentration and gradually increasing it. This approach helps gauge skin tolerance. Keep track of how your skin reacts. Record any irritation or sensitivity. Adjust the formulation based on these observations. Monitoring results aids in refining the product for better outcomes.
Sodium Ascorbyl Phosphate (SAP) is a stable form of vitamin C, highly valued in cosmetics. It offers many benefits, including brightening skin and providing antioxidant protection. Incorporating 99 percent pure SAP powder into cosmetic formulations requires careful consideration.
To begin with, mix the powder in water-based formulations. It dissolves well in water, ensuring an even distribution. Use warm water to speed up the dissolving process. However, if the temperature is too high, the stability of SAP may diminish. Adjust accordingly.
Consider the pH of the final product. Sodium Ascorbyl Phosphate is most effective at a pH level between 6 and 7. If the formula is too acidic, it could convert to ascorbic acid, losing its benefits. Adding pH stabilizers can help maintain the right balance. Some trial and error may be necessary to achieve optimal results. Experimentation with different concentrations is also vital. Too much SAP can cause irritation, while too little may not provide desired effects. Finding the right blend is a process that requires patience.
Sodium Ascorbyl Phosphate (SAP) is highly effective in skincare. However, its stability and storage conditions are critical for optimal performance. This compound, which is a stable form of Vitamin C, can degrade in poor conditions. The ideal storage temperature is below 25 degrees Celsius. Humidity can also impact its efficacy. Keeping it in a cool, dry place is essential.
When using SAP, avoid exposure to light. Light can break down many cosmetic ingredients. Use opaque containers to shield the powder from UV rays. This simple step can greatly extend its shelf life and effectiveness. Research shows that products stored correctly show up to 90% of their expected potency over six months.
Tips: Always check the packaging for expiration dates. Even stable ingredients can lose potency over time. If you notice any discoloration or changes in texture, it may be time to replace it. Remember, proper storage is not just about making it last longer; it's also about maintaining its beneficial properties.
